How Long Do Plastic Pallets Last?

The most honest answer to “how long do plastic pallets last?” is a range, not a single number. Under standard indoor warehouse conditions, a quality plastic pallet will last 7 to 10 years. Heavy-duty plastic pallet lifespan can reach 10 to 15 years for virgin HDPE/PP injection-molded designs, while lightweight export pallets may deliver only 3 to 5 years because they are engineered for lower weight and fewer handling cycles.

Recycled-content pallets fall in the middle, typically 6 to 10 years, depending on the percentage of recycled resin and the quality of the blend. These figures come from manufacturer consensus and industry guidance, not from a single universal test, so always ask your supplier for model-specific data.

Plastic pallet lifespan by type

Pallet type Typical lifespan Estimated trips/cycles Best suited for
Standard quality plastic pallets 7–10 years 100–250+ General warehouse, floor storage, stacking
Heavy-duty / virgin HDPE or PP 10–15 years 250–500+ Racking, heavy manufacturing, closed-loop systems
Recycled-content plastic pallets 6–10 years 50–100+ Sustainability-focused programs, moderate loads
Lightweight / export plastic pallets 3–5 years 20–50+ One-way shipping, light export loads

These ranges assume indoor storage, loads within rated capacity, and reasonable handling. A pallet stored outdoors in direct sunlight, overloaded repeatedly, or dropped from forklifts will fall to the low end, or fail early.

Why trips matter more than years

Calendar years can be misleading. A pallet moved once a month in climate-controlled storage will age slowly. The same pallet moved five times a day through a freezer, wash cycle, and racking system will accumulate fatigue far faster. That is why experienced buyers ask: “How many trips can it complete?” rather than “How many years will it last?”

ORBIS, a leading reusable packaging manufacturer, reports that its heavy-duty plastic pallets can complete 250+ cycles, with some designs such as the Odyssey line reaching 400+ cycles. By comparison, wood pallets in high-use environments often need repair or replacement after 11–50 trips. The cycle perspective explains why plastic can be cheaper over time even when the invoice price is three times higher.

Plastic Pallet Lifespan vs. Wood Pallets

Most buyers evaluating plastic are coming from wood. The comparison matters because wood still holds the majority of the pallet market, and it remains the right choice for some applications. For buyers weighing plastic pallets vs wood lifespan, the trip-count model usually favors plastic in repeated-use systems. The lifespan difference, however, is significant.

Factor Plastic pallets Wood pallets
Typical lifespan 7–15 years 2–5 years
Estimated trips 100–500+ 11–50
Moisture resistance High Low (absorbs water, rots, warps)
Pest resistance High Vulnerable to insects and mold
Repairability Limited Easier to repair
Maintenance Low Higher (nails, splinters, repairs)
Consistency High dimensional consistency Variable by batch

Plastic wins on longevity and consistency. It does not absorb moisture, does not splinter, and does not require heat treatment for export. Wood wins on upfront cost and local repairability. For one-way domestic shipments or operations with low recovery rates, wood can still be the practical choice.

7 Factors That Affect Plastic Pallet Lifespan

Lifespan is not a property of the pallet alone. It is the result of seven interacting factors. Understanding them helps you match the pallet to the application rather than buying on price alone.

1. Material quality

The two most common resins are high-density polyethylene (HDPE) and polypropylene (PP). HDPE offers better impact resistance and performs well in cold environments. PP provides more stiffness and better heat tolerance. Virgin resin generally lasts longer than recycled blends, though high-quality recycled pallets can still deliver strong plastic pallet durability. 2. Design and wall thickness

Injection-molded pallets with thick walls, reinforced corners, and robust runners withstand more impacts than thin, thermoformed designs. Three-runner bases, six-runner bases, and steel-reinforced plastic pallets each behave differently under load. The right design depends on whether the pallet sits on the floor, travels on forklifts, or lives in a rack.

3. Load capacity and load distribution

Exceeding the rated static, dynamic, or racking load is one of the fastest ways to shorten lifespan. Even more common is poor load distribution: a heavy point load in the center or a load that overhangs the deck can cause premature deflection and cracking. Always follow the manufacturer’s ratings and remember that static load capacity is not the same as racking load capacity.

4. Handling practices

Forklift impacts, drops, dragging across rough floors, and improper tine spacing all create stress concentrations. Operators trained on proper fork entry and gentle placement can extend pallet life by years. One bad drop onto a concrete floor can crack a runner that would otherwise last a decade.

5. Environment

UV exposure is the silent killer of outdoor plastic pallet storage. Prolonged sunlight causes discoloration, chalking, and brittleness. Temperature extremes also matter: HDPE becomes more brittle at very low temperatures, while PP can soften in high heat. Rapid temperature swings, moving a pallet directly from a -20°C freezer to a warm loading dock, can create thermal shock and cracking.

6. Application intensity

A pallet in an automated warehouse with conveyors, sensors, and racking experiences different wear than one in static floor storage. High-turnover e-commerce operations accumulate cycles quickly. AS/RS systems demand tight dimensional tolerance; once a pallet warps or sags, it may no longer function reliably in automation.

7. Maintenance and inspection

Pallets that are cleaned, inspected, and rotated regularly last longer. Damage spotted early can be addressed before it spreads. Pallets left dirty, stacked unevenly, or stored in standing water degrade faster. A simple inspection schedule can add years to a fleet.

How to Extend Plastic Pallet Lifespan

Small operational changes often add more years than switching to a more expensive model. These practices directly improve plastic pallet longevity and lower cost per trip. Here are practical steps that logistics teams can implement immediately.

  1. Train forklift operators. Proper tine spacing, slow approach angles, and gentle lowering reduce impact damage at entry points and corners.
  2. Distribute loads evenly. Keep weight centered and avoid point loads. Place heavier items at the bottom of the stack.
  3. Respect rated capacities. Use the dynamic load rating for transport and the racking load rating for rack storage. Never use the static rating as a shortcut.
  4. Store indoors or under cover. If outdoor storage is unavoidable, specify UV-stabilized resin and cover stacks with tarps.
  5. Allow thermal acclimation. Move cold-stored pallets gradually to warmer zones to reduce thermal shock.
  6. Clean regularly. Use compatible detergents and pressures. For food and pharmaceutical use, follow sanitation protocols without exposing pallets to chemicals that degrade the resin.
  7. Inspect on a schedule. Check monthly or quarterly for cracks, deformation, runner damage, and exposed reinforcement. Remove damaged units immediately.
  8. Rotate stock. Do not let the same pallets always carry the heaviest loads. Rotation spreads wear across the fleet.

Industry-Specific Lifespan Considerations

Different industries stress pallets in different ways. A pallet that lasts 12 years in floor storage may last half that time in a high-cycle freezer or automated system.

Food and pharmaceutical

Frequent wash cycles and chemical sanitation are standard. These processes are necessary for hygiene, but harsh chemicals or excessive pressure can degrade plastic over time. Closed-deck hygienic designs are easier to clean and inspect, which helps teams spot damage early. Lifespan here depends heavily on wash frequency and chemical compatibility.

Cold storage and freezer operations

HDPE generally performs better than PP at low temperatures, but all plastics become less impact-resistant as temperatures drop. The bigger risk is thermal shock: moving a frozen pallet directly into a warm area can cause microcracks. Allowing an acclimation period is one of the simplest ways to extend life.

Automated warehouses and AS/RS

Dimensional consistency is everything in automation. A pallet that bows, warps, or loses its squareness can jam conveyors or misalign in racks. These systems also accumulate cycles rapidly, so even durable pallets may need replacement sooner than expected. Choose designs with proven automation compatibility and tight tolerances.

Automotive and heavy manufacturing

Heavy components and steel reinforcement create high static and dynamic loads. Inspect for exposed steel, cracked welds, and runner damage. In these applications, safety margin matters as much as lifespan: a failed pallet can damage product and equipment.

Retail and e-commerce

Loads are often moderate, but trip frequency is high. A pallet used daily in a fast-moving fulfillment center can accumulate hundreds of cycles in a year. The key to long life is matching the pallet to the cycle intensity and avoiding mixed handling with wood pallets that have different dimensions and damage profiles.

Export and one-way shipping

Lightweight export pallets are engineered for cost and weight savings, not maximum durability. In one-way applications, lifespan is less important than freight efficiency and destination compliance. If the pallet is recovered and reused, expect a shorter service life than a heavy-duty closed-loop model.


When to Repair vs. Replace a Plastic Pallet

Plastic pallets are not as easy to repair as wood, but minor damage can sometimes be addressed. The decision comes down to safety, cost, and structural integrity.

Repair when:

  • The damage is limited to a small surface crack or minor abrasion.
  • A replaceable component, such as a deck board or anti-slip insert, can be swapped.
  • The repair cost is clearly below 30–40% of replacement cost.
  • Load-bearing areas are not affected.

Replace when:

  • Cracks appear in runners, corners, or other load-bearing areas.
  • The deck is significantly deformed or bowed.
  • Steel reinforcement is exposed or corroded.
  • More than 20–30% of structural elements are compromised.
  • The pallet has lost its rated load capacity or no longer fits automation.

A simple rule: if you would not trust the pallet to carry your most valuable load, remove it from service. Keeping a damaged pallet in circulation risks product damage, racking failure, and injury.


Cost per Trip: Why Lifespan Matters Financially

The upfront price of a plastic pallet is usually two to four times that of a wood pallet. The financial advantage appears over time through lower cost per trip. Here is a simple formula:

Cost per trip = (purchase price + cleaning + repair + repositioning − recovery value) ÷ completed trips

A worked example shows why this matters:

Pallet type Purchase price Expected trips Cleaning/repair per trip Cost per trip
Heavy-duty plastic $80 250 $0.10 $0.42
Standard wood $15 25 $0.30 $0.90

In this simplified scenario, the plastic pallet costs less than half per trip despite the higher purchase price. Your actual numbers will vary with recovery rate, handling intensity, and local labor costs, but the principle holds: longer lifespan lowers the real cost of each successful move.

Frequently Asked Questions

How long do plastic pallets last on average?

Quality plastic pallets last 7 to 10 years on average in normal warehouse conditions. Heavy-duty designs can reach 10 to 15 years, while lightweight export pallets may last only 3 to 5 years.

Do plastic pallets last longer than wood pallets?

Yes, in most repeated-use applications. Plastic pallets typically last 2 to 3 times longer than wood pallets and can complete many more trips before replacement.

Can plastic pallets be stored outside?

They can, but prolonged UV exposure shortens lifespan unless the resin includes UV stabilizers. Covered or indoor storage is recommended for maximum service life.

How many times can a plastic pallet be reused?

Standard pallets often complete 100–250+ trips, while heavy-duty models can reach 250–500+ trips. Export or lightweight pallets are designed for fewer cycles.

What is the lifespan of a recycled plastic pallet?

Recycled-content plastic pallets typically last 6 to 10 years, depending on the percentage and quality of recycled resin and the application intensity.

How do I know when to replace a plastic pallet?

Replace it when you see cracks in load-bearing areas, significant deformation, exposed steel reinforcement, or loss of rated capacity. A good rule of thumb is to retire any pallet you would not trust with your heaviest load.

Does UV exposure shorten plastic pallet lifespan?

Yes. UV radiation degrades plastic over time, causing discoloration, chalking, and brittleness. UV-stabilized grades and covered storage reduce this effect.

Are plastic pallets worth the higher upfront cost?

For closed-loop, high-cycle operations, plastic pallets usually have a lower cost per trip and total cost of ownership over time. For one-way shipments or low-recovery operations, wood may remain more economical.
